there is no hot water or very little hot water for a bath. i have a Parkray solid fuel fire which heats the water the radiators are red hot ,but the hot water has gone warm and after one bath goes cold

Do the two pipes that go into the side of the hot water cylinder (usually one in the middle and the other towards the bottom both feel hot, or are neither hot? Do you know if there's a pump that feeds water to these two pipes (or does it work without a pump - called gravity feed - common on systems designed up to say 20 years ago.
